Output 73699882a5dba38a897bde15adfb1d5706903c1e78e62f673585990b961deef2:1

value
1441576690
script pubkey
OP_0 OP_PUSHBYTES_20 ba885f1836719344a0fc5c1fe5730a39a558f267
address
ltc1qh2y97xpkwxf5fg8uts072uc28xj43un8esgtyh
transaction
73699882a5dba38a897bde15adfb1d5706903c1e78e62f673585990b961deef2
spent
true